Sumario: | In the breading season 1991-1992 a mixed water-bird colony of about 400 nests of Egretta thula. Casmerodius albus. Nycticorax nycticorax. Ardea cocoi and Anhinga anhinga appeared at Laguna Iberá, Corrientes Provinee, Argentina. It was unique for its type in the arca, Observations were carried out during two breeding seasons. The dominant species during the first season was E, thula (52.5 %ofthe nests) followed by C. albus, During the next season the colony expanded in area and in number ofnests (87 %). The dominant speeies was now C. albus, with 80,5 %of the nests and a growth of399 %. AII the remaining speeies declined, andN. nycticorax was apparently absent. Evaluation ofthe impaet ofhuman visitors on the eolony require further monitoring. |
